🇧🇦 Sarajevo: A Severely Underrated Visa-Free Destination
These photos capture the soul of Sarajevo—the capital of visa-free Bosnia and Herzegovina. Though compact, this city echoes with profound history. On a single street in Sarajevo, you’ll find a Catholic church 🕍, an Orthodox chapel, and a mosque 🕌 standing just steps apart. One moment, you’re immersed in the solemn chimes of church bells; the next, the call to prayer drifts through the air. This cultural harmony earned it the nickname "European Jerusalem." At the Latin Bridge 🌉, where World War I was triggered, life now unfolds peacefully along the riverbank. Yet bullet scars on buildings remain as stark reminders of the city’s wartime wounds.
